Irrational Malfeasance On Steroids

Of course it makes sense. Not! The S&P 500 opened the new year and decade at 3258 or 37% above the Christmas Eve lows of 2018 and 23% above the level of March 2018 (2640). The latter occurred at a time when the corporate tax cut sugar high was cranking through the GDP statistics and before the […]
You must be a Stockman's Corner member in order to view this post, subscribe to Monthly Subscription, Quarterly Subscription or Annual Subscription.